What are some community organizations in Fall River?

Fall River is home to a wealth of community organizations dedicated to various causes and interests. Examples include the Fall River Historical Society, preserving and sharing the city's rich heritage; the Fall River Area Chamber of Commerce, supporting local businesses and economic growth; and numerous non-profit organizations addressing social issues such as poverty, homelessness, and healthcare access. These organizations often host events, volunteer opportunities, and educational programs, offering numerous pathways to connect with the community. Checking their websites or contacting them directly will provide updated information on current initiatives.

How can I find volunteer opportunities in Fall River?

Contributing your time through volunteering is a rewarding way to connect with the Fall River community and make a tangible difference. Several organizations offer volunteer opportunities, including the United Way of Greater Fall River, local food banks, animal shelters, and environmental groups. Many community centers and churches also coordinate volunteer initiatives. Websites like VolunteerMatch and Idealist can connect you with suitable opportunities based on your skills and interests. Contacting organizations directly is another effective way to inquire about current volunteer needs.

What are some resources for finding community connections in Fall River?

Several resources can help you navigate the community landscape of Fall River. The city's official website provides information on local government initiatives and community events. The Fall River Area Chamber of Commerce offers a comprehensive directory of local businesses and organizations. Local newspapers and community newsletters often feature articles and announcements highlighting community events and volunteer opportunities. Online platforms like Nextdoor and Facebook groups dedicated to Fall River residents can also prove invaluable for discovering local events, engaging in discussions, and connecting with neighbours.
